电动助力转向系统电动机与减速机构的匹配研究 被引量:4

A Study on the Matching of the Motor and Reduction Gear for Electric Power-Assist Steering System
在线阅读 下载PDF
导出
摘要 现在的电动助力转向系统都存在助力电动机和减速机构,而助力电动机的工作状况是复杂多变的,因此需要电动机和减速机构合理匹配才能够满足要求。在考虑汽车转向功能要求的情况下,通过分析电动助力转向系统的电动机电气参数和减速机构之间的关系,提出二者匹配的指标;依此为依据,探讨电动助力转向系统设计的程序,这对电动助力转向系统的开发具有指导意义。 All electric power-assist steering systems now have electric power-assist motor and reduction gear, and the motor must work in various conditions, so correct matching of them is necessary. The requirements of steering performance are considered, and an index is presented based on the analysis of the electric parameters of the motor and the reduction gear in electric power-assist steering system.According to the study result, the technical route of design process for electric power-assist steering system is discussed, which are useful for development of such system.
